Run black linter and enforce going forward
This commit is contained in:
parent
54c8a7dea1
commit
c820395dbf
@ -37,7 +37,8 @@ install:
|
||||
python wait_for.py
|
||||
fi
|
||||
script:
|
||||
- make test
|
||||
- make test-only
|
||||
- if [[ $TRAVIS_PYTHON_VERSION == "3.7" ]]; then make lint; fi
|
||||
after_success:
|
||||
- coveralls
|
||||
before_deploy:
|
||||
|
6
Makefile
6
Makefile
@ -14,12 +14,16 @@ init:
|
||||
|
||||
lint:
|
||||
flake8 moto
|
||||
black --check moto/ tests/
|
||||
|
||||
test: lint
|
||||
test-only:
|
||||
rm -f .coverage
|
||||
rm -rf cover
|
||||
@nosetests -sv --with-coverage --cover-html ./tests/ $(TEST_EXCLUDE)
|
||||
|
||||
|
||||
test: lint test-only
|
||||
|
||||
test_server:
|
||||
@TEST_SERVER_MODE=true nosetests -sv --with-coverage --cover-html ./tests/
|
||||
|
||||
|
@ -7,9 +7,9 @@
|
||||
[![Docs](https://readthedocs.org/projects/pip/badge/?version=stable)](http://docs.getmoto.org)
|
||||
![PyPI](https://img.shields.io/pypi/v/moto.svg)
|
||||
![PyPI - Python Version](https://img.shields.io/pypi/pyversions/moto.svg)
|
||||
![PyPI - Downloads](https://img.shields.io/pypi/dw/moto.svg)
|
||||
![PyPI - Downloads](https://img.shields.io/pypi/dw/moto.svg) [![Code style: black](https://img.shields.io/badge/code%20style-black-000000.svg)](https://github.com/psf/black)
|
||||
|
||||
# In a nutshell
|
||||
## In a nutshell
|
||||
|
||||
Moto is a library that allows your tests to easily mock out AWS Services.
|
||||
|
||||
|
@ -1,6 +1,7 @@
|
||||
-r requirements.txt
|
||||
mock
|
||||
nose
|
||||
black; python_version >= '3.6'
|
||||
sure==1.4.11
|
||||
coverage
|
||||
flake8==3.7.8
|
||||
|
Loading…
Reference in New Issue
Block a user